Svitolina and Stakhovsky sold their rackets at charity auctions

Athletes support their country

Ukrainian tennis players Elina Svitolina and Sergei Stakhovsky participated in charity auctions in support of Ukraine.

In Fulham, the racket of the Ukrainian tennis player and her uniform from the winning match for third place at the Tokyo Olympics were sold. The auction took place as part of a tennis day at The Parsons Green Club.

In turn, Stakhovsky sold his racket at a charity auction in Bratislava, with which he played the last match in the Ukrainian national team.

All the money raised during the auctions was transferred to Elina Svitolina’s charitable foundation and the Hospitallers’ Fund of Ukraine.

Early on the morning of February 24, Russia launched rocket and air strikes on most Ukrainian cities and then launched a full-scale military invasion. The war against Russia continues for the 123rd day.
